Field Care Supervisor – Domiciliary Care

Location: Doncaster

Job Type: Full-time or Part-time, Permanent

Hours: Up to 40 hours per week

Salary: £13.25 per hour

An excellent domiciliary care provider is looking to recruit a dedicated Field Care Supervisor to join their growing team on a permanent basis.

This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ced care professional who is passionate about delivering outstanding person-centred care while supporting and developing a team of care staff. You'll work closely with the Registered Manager and wider management team, playing a key role in maintaining high standards of care and supporting the continued growth of the service.

Responsibilities

  • Provide leadership and support to a team of care staff delivering domiciliary care.
  • Conduct care quality monitoring, spot checks, supervisions, and competency assessments.
  • Ensure care is delivered in line with CQC standards and individual care plans.
  • Support with staff mentoring, training, and performance management.
  • Assist with care planning, risk assessments, and service reviews.
  • Work collaboratively with the management team to ensure compliance with policies and procedures.
  • Build positive relationships with service users, their families, and healthcare professionals.
  • Travel across the Barnsley area to support staff and service users as required.

What We're Looking For

  • Previous experience in a Team Leader or Field Care Supervisor role within adult social care.
  • Strong leadership and communication skills.
  • Passion for delivering high-quality, person-centred care.
  • Excellent organisational skills with the ability to manage competing priorities.
  • Good understanding of CQC regulations and compliance requirements.
  • A full UK driving licence and access to your own vehicle are essential.
